Cultural Nuances in Friendship
What’s fascinating about watching Chinese dramas is how they weave in cultural nuances into the theme of friendship. You might see elements of respect for elders, the importance of family, or traditional values influencing how friendships are formed and maintained. These cultural layers add depth and richness to the storytelling, offering a glimpse into a different way of life. For example, the concept of "face" (面子 miànzi) can play a significant role, where friends might go to great lengths to help each other save face in social situations. This cultural context enriches the portrayal of 'sahabat sejatiku', making it both unique and universally relatable.

"Go Ahead" (以家人之名)
"Go Ahead" is a heartwarming drama that revolves around three unrelated individuals who grow up together as siblings. The bond they share is not one of blood, but one of choice and unwavering support. They face challenges together, navigate the complexities of adolescence, and eventually find their own paths in life. Each character brings a unique dynamic to the group, creating a family unit founded on love, understanding, and mutual respect. This drama beautifully portrays the essence of 'sahabat sejatiku' by demonstrating that family isn't just about blood relations, but about the people who choose to be there for you. The drama is celebrated for its realistic portrayal of family dynamics and the emotional depth of its characters.
"Ode to Joy" (欢乐颂)
"Ode to Joy" is a modern drama that follows the lives of five women living on the same floor of an apartment building in Shanghai. Each woman has a distinct personality, background, and set of aspirations. As they navigate their careers, relationships, and personal struggles, they form a close-knit bond of friendship. They support each other, offer advice, and celebrate each other's successes. This drama showcases the power of female friendship and how women can empower each other in a competitive urban environment. The characters face realistic challenges, making their bond all the more relatable. The drama has been praised for its realistic portrayal of modern women and the complexities of their lives.
"A Love So Beautiful" (致我们单纯的小美好)
While primarily a romance, "A Love So Beautiful" also highlights the importance of friendship. The drama follows a group of high school friends as they navigate the ups and downs of adolescence. They support each other through academic pressures, romantic pursuits, and personal growth. The friendships are lighthearted and fun, but also demonstrate the loyalty and camaraderie that define true friendships. The drama provides a nostalgic look at high school friendships and the enduring bonds that can be formed during those formative years. It captures the innocence and simplicity of youth, making it a heartwarming and relatable watch.

How to Find More Dramas Like This
If you're now on the hunt for more dramas that capture the essence of 'sahabat sejatiku', here’s some advice. Start by exploring drama recommendation sites and forums. Websites like MyDramaList and AsianWiki are great resources for finding dramas based on genre, theme, and country of origin. Look for dramas tagged with keywords like "friendship," "slice of life," "family," and "coming-of-age." Also, pay attention to reviews and ratings from other viewers. Often, these reviews will highlight the strengths and weaknesses of a drama, helping you decide if it's the right fit for you.
